LNG Fails to Displace Coal in India, Undermining "Bridge Fuel" Claims
WASHINGTON, June 11 (TNSLrpt) -- A report from the Institute for Energy Economics and Financial Analysis, a parent agency, reveals that liquefied natural gas is not effectively replacing coal consumption in India, the world's second-largest coal-consuming nation. The IEEFA's analysis, conducted by researchers Sam Reynolds and Purva Jain, challenges the global oil and gas industry's assertion that LNG serves as a "bridge fuel" in the transition from coal to cleaner energy sources.
